Henkell Trocken

Posted on January 15, 2010 by nara

HENKELL TROCKEN is a Fine Sekt sparkling wine, product of Germany consist of 11.5% alc/vol. Since “trocken” means “dry,” this is a DRY SEC.

This sparkling wine was probably made in the charmat method like the Prosecco, and in the same way, it lost its fizz pretty quickly.

This New Year I enjoyed this wonderful champagne.
